var DANGEROUS_ENV_PATTERNS = [
/^NEXT_PUBLIC_.*SECRET/i,
/^NEXT_PUBLIC_.*KEY/i,
/^NEXT_PUBLIC_.*TOKEN/i,
/^NEXT_PUBLIC_.*PASSWORD/i,
/^NEXT_PUBLIC_.*PRIVATE/i,
/^NEXT_PUBLIC_.*API_SECRET/i,
/^NEXT_PUBLIC_.*DATABASE/i
];
// src/core/env-validator.ts
function validateEnvironmentVariables(config = {}) {
const errors = [];
const warnings = [];
const exposedVars = [];
const publicVars = Object.keys(process.env).filter((key) => key.startsWith("NEXT_PUBLIC_"));
exposedVars.push(...publicVars);
for (const varName of publicVars) {
const isDangerous = DANGEROUS_ENV_PATTERNS.some((pattern) => pattern.test(varName));
if (isDangerous) {
const isAllowed = config.allowedPublicVars?.includes(varName);
if (!isAllowed) {
errors.push(
`Potentially sensitive environment variable exposed: ${varName}. Consider moving to server-side only or add to allowedPublicVars if intentional.`
);
}
}
}
if (config.allowedPublicVars) {
for (const varName of publicVars) {
if (!config.allowedPublicVars.includes(varName)) {
warnings.push(
`Environment variable ${varName} is not in allowedPublicVars list. Consider adding it explicitly or removing NEXT_PUBLIC_ prefix.`
);
}
}
}
if (config.schema) {
try {
const envObject = Object.fromEntries(publicVars.map((key) => [key, process.env[key]]));
config.schema.parse(envObject);
} catch (error) {
if (error instanceof ZodError) {
errors.push(`Environment schema validation failed: ${error.message}`);
} else {
errors.push(
`Environment schema validation failed: ${error instanceof Error ? error.message : "Unknown error"}`
);
}
}
}
return {
isValid: errors.length === 0,
errors,
warnings,
exposedVars
};
}
